Banihal MLA Sajjad Shaheen and Budhal MLA Javid Iqbal called on Chief Minister Omar Abdullah at the Civil Secretariat on Tuesday. An official statement said they discussed key developmental issues concerning their respective constituencies and sought the government’s intervention in addressing the pressing needs of the people.

Advertisement

The Chief Minister assured them that the concerns raised would be duly examined and appropriate steps taken to ensure balanced development across all regions, officials said. Meanwhile, the statement said that the Union Bank of India today extended support to the ongoing flood relief efforts in Jammu and Kashmir by contributing Rs 1 crore. A cheque was formally handed over to Omar Abdullah at the Civil Secretariat here.

Expressing gratitude, the Chief Minister appreciated the gesture of the bank, noting that such contributions would significantly aid in relief and rehabilitation measures for the affected people, the statement said, adding that CM said collective efforts from institutions and individuals play a crucial role in helping the union territory recover from the calamity.
